This strawberry romaine salad is refreshing and pretty. This salad travels well, just save the dressing and use it just before serving.
Ingredients
- 1 head romaine lettuce - rinsed , dried, and chopped
- 2 bunches fresh spinach - chopped , washed and dried
- 1 pint fresh strawberries , sliced
- 1 Bermuda onion , sliced
- 0.5 cups mayonnaise
- 2 tablespoons white wine vinegar
- 0.33 cups white sugar
- 0.25 cups milk
- 2 tablespoons poppy seeds
Instructions
-
1
Combine romaine, spinach, strawberries, and sliced onion in a large salad bowl.
-
2
Combine mayonnaise, vinegar, sugar, milk and poppy seeds in a jar with a tight fitting lid; shake well. Pour dressing over salad and toss until evenly coated.
